GI.Gst.Structs.Structure

Exported types

data Structure

newZeroStructure

noStructure

Methods

canIntersect

structureCanIntersect

copy

structureCopy

filterAndMapInPlace

structureFilterAndMapInPlace

fixate

structureFixate

fixateField

structureFixateField

fixateFieldBoolean

structureFixateFieldBoolean

fixateFieldNearestDouble

structureFixateFieldNearestDouble

fixateFieldNearestFraction

structureFixateFieldNearestFraction

fixateFieldNearestInt

structureFixateFieldNearestInt

fixateFieldString

structureFixateFieldString

foreach

structureForeach

free

structureFree

fromString

structureFromString

getArray

structureGetArray

getBoolean

structureGetBoolean

getClockTime

structureGetClockTime

getDate

structureGetDate

getDateTime

structureGetDateTime

getDouble

structureGetDouble

getEnum

structureGetEnum

getFieldType

structureGetFieldType

getFlagset

structureGetFlagset

getFraction

structureGetFraction

getInt

structureGetInt

getInt64

structureGetInt64

getList

structureGetList

getName

structureGetName

getNameId

structureGetNameId

getString

structureGetString

getUint

structureGetUint

getUint64

structureGetUint64

getValue

structureGetValue

hasField

structureHasField

hasFieldTyped

structureHasFieldTyped

hasName

structureHasName

idGetValue

structureIdGetValue

idHasField

structureIdHasField

idHasFieldTyped

structureIdHasFieldTyped

idSetValue

structureIdSetValue

idTakeValue

structureIdTakeValue

intersect

structureIntersect

isEqual

structureIsEqual

isSubset

structureIsSubset

mapInPlace

structureMapInPlace

nFields

structureNFields

newEmpty

structureNewEmpty

newFromString

structureNewFromString

newIdEmpty

structureNewIdEmpty

nthFieldName

structureNthFieldName

removeAllFields

structureRemoveAllFields

removeField

structureRemoveField

setArray

structureSetArray

setList

structureSetList

setName

structureSetName

setParentRefcount

structureSetParentRefcount

setValue

structureSetValue

takeValue

structureTakeValue

toString

structureToString

Properties

type

getStructureType

setStructureType